A Distinguished Career Forged in Finance and Gemmology
Jacqui Larsson brings nearly two decades of invaluable experience to Opsydia. Her journey began far from the glittering world of gemstones, qualifying as a chartered accountant. This foundational period saw her working in prestigious international professional services firms across Australia, Hong Kong, and the United Kingdom, before transitioning into the dynamic fields of banking and finance. This early career phase provided her with a robust commercial grounding, honing her sales and client management skills, instilling an inherent appreciation for stringent controls and meticulous risk assessment, and familiarizing her with the critical nuances of financial reporting. These capabilities are particularly pertinent in the high-value and often opaque world of precious stones, where trust, accountability, and robust financial oversight are paramount.
Driven by a profound passion for the industry, Larsson embarked on a career break that marked a significant pivot towards her true calling. During this time, she successfully completed both the Gemmological Association of Great Britain (Gem-A) Gemmology Diploma and the highly regarded Diamond Diploma. Her dedication further led her to secure a coveted internship at the Diamond Trading Company (DTC), a pivotal part of the De Beers Group. This immersive experience allowed her to meticulously study the entire diamond pipeline, from sorting rough goods to evaluating polished stones, and to critically review the rough-to-polished strategy. Such comprehensive exposure provided her with an intimate understanding of the diamond journey, from its origins to its market destination.
Leveraging this profound industry insight, Larsson later ventured into entrepreneurship, founding Carob & Co, a fine jewellery business that successfully operated in both London and Amsterdam. This venture solidified her commercial understanding of the luxury market and the specific demands of consumers seeking quality and provenance.

Unveiling Opsydia’s Cutting-Edge Traceability Technology
Opsydia is globally recognized for its pioneering laser technology that meticulously places unique identifiers both on and, crucially, beneath the surface of gemstones. This innovative approach ensures the immutable security and verifiable identity of each stone. By establishing a direct, physical, and tamper-proof link between a gemstone and its digital records—whether a blockchain entry or a traditional grading report—Opsydia effectively completes the traceable journey of any diamond or coloured gemstone. This unbroken chain of custody, from mine to market, fundamentally bolsters transparency initiatives, reinforces supply chain provenance, and significantly enhances consumer confidence in the authenticity and ethical sourcing of their precious purchases.
The proprietary technology employed by Opsydia offers an unparalleled level of security. Traditional surface inscriptions can be removed or altered, but Opsydia’s sub-surface inscriptions are embedded within the stone itself, making them virtually impossible to tamper with without damaging the gem. This distinct advantage provides a new standard for anti-counterfeiting measures and ensures that the unique identifier remains inextricably linked to the stone throughout its lifespan and multiple ownership transfers.
Scalable Solutions for Industrial Demand
Opsydia’s advanced systems—the D4000, D5000, and D6000—are engineered for high-volume industrial environments. These robust machines are capable of processing an impressive 50,000 to 100,000 stones per year, offering a practical, efficient, and scalable solution to pervasive diamond identification and traceability concerns. This industrial capacity means that Opsydia can provide verifiable provenance for a significant portion of the global gemstone trade, making genuine impact on an industry that has long sought reliable methods for secure identification and ethical sourcing.
